Ingredients

Before you start cooking, make sure that you have all the necessary ingredients. Here's what you'll need: - 4 boneless chicken breasts - 2 tablespoons of olive oil - 2 tablespoons of black pepper - 1 tablespoon of paprika - 1 tablespoon of garlic powder - 1 tablespoon of onion powder - 1 teaspoon of salt

Instructions

Here's how to cook the peppered chicken: 1.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C). 2. In a small bowl, mix together the black pepper, paprika, garlic powder, onion powder, and salt. 3. Rub the chicken breasts with the olive oil. 4. Sprinkle the spice mixture over the chicken, making sure to coat both sides evenly. 5. Place the chicken breasts in a baking dish and bake in the preheated oven for 25-30 minutes, or until the chicken is cooked through. 6. Once the chicken is cooked, remove it from the oven and let it rest for a few minutes before serving.

Variations

If you want to switch things up a bit, here are a few variations of this recipe that you can try: - Use different spices: Instead of using black pepper, paprika, garlic powder, onion powder, and salt, you can experiment with different spices. For example, you can use cumin, coriander, chili powder, or curry powder. - Add vegetables: You can add some vegetables to the baking dish to make it a complete meal. Some good options include bell peppers, onions, zucchini, and mushrooms. - Make it spicy: If you like your food spicy, you can add some cayenne pepper or red pepper flakes to the spice mixture.
